


The PHP form processing revolution: changing the way websites interact
PHP Form handling has always been an integral part of website development, but in recent years it has undergone a radical transformation, changing the way websites interact. These changes include:
Popularization of Ajax and JSON
The advent ofajax (asynchronous javascript and XML) and JSON (JavaScript Object Notation) allows forms to be submitted asynchronously without reloading the entire page. This greatly improves the user experience as users can receive immediate feedback on form submissions without having to wait for the page to reload.
Front-end validation and responsive design
Modern php Frameworks and form libraries, such as Laravel and Bootstrap, provide extensive form validation capabilities. These features allow developers to perform input validation on the client side, reducing load on the server side and improving security. Additionally, responsive design ensures the form works well on a variety of devices, providing a seamless user experience.
Cloud Computing and API Integration
The rise ofcloud computing and api integrations allows developers to leverage powerful third-party services to handle form submissions. For example, you can use the Email API to automatically send confirmation emails, or the Payment Gateway API to process payments. This simplifies the form processing process and increases development efficiency.
Seamless integration of mobile devices
With the proliferation of mobile devices, form processing must seamlessly adapt to various screen sizes and input methods. The PHP form framework now offers mobile-friendly features such as touch event handling and adaptive layout. This ensures that users can easily fill out the form on smartphones and tablets.
Artificial Intelligence and Natural Language Processing
Artificial Intelligence (ai) and Natural Language Processing (NLP) are being used to enhance form processing. For example, chatbots can assist users in filling out forms, while NLP algorithms can automatically extract data from free text input. These techniques reduce user input burden and improve data accuracy.
Security and Data ProtectionSecurity in form processing is critical because forms often collect sensitive user data. PHP frameworks and form libraries provide strong security measures such as Cross-site Request Forgery (CSRF) protection and input filtering to prevent malicious attacks. Additionally, data protection regulations, such as GDPR, require developers to follow strict privacy practices to protect user data.
in conclusionPHP’s revolutionary evolution in form processing has revolutionized website interaction. With Ajax,
front-endvalidation, cloud integration, mobile-friendliness, AI and enhanced security, form processing is now more powerful, user-friendly and secure than ever. These changes provide developers with new tools and technologies that enable them to create efficient, intuitive, and highly secure forms that enhance the overall user experience.

PHP type prompts to improve code quality and readability. 1) Scalar type tips: Since PHP7.0, basic data types are allowed to be specified in function parameters, such as int, float, etc. 2) Return type prompt: Ensure the consistency of the function return value type. 3) Union type prompt: Since PHP8.0, multiple types are allowed to be specified in function parameters or return values. 4) Nullable type prompt: Allows to include null values and handle functions that may return null values.

In PHP, use the clone keyword to create a copy of the object and customize the cloning behavior through the \_\_clone magic method. 1. Use the clone keyword to make a shallow copy, cloning the object's properties but not the object's properties. 2. The \_\_clone method can deeply copy nested objects to avoid shallow copying problems. 3. Pay attention to avoid circular references and performance problems in cloning, and optimize cloning operations to improve efficiency.

Key players in HTTP cache headers include Cache-Control, ETag, and Last-Modified. 1.Cache-Control is used to control caching policies. Example: Cache-Control:max-age=3600,public. 2. ETag verifies resource changes through unique identifiers, example: ETag: "686897696a7c876b7e". 3.Last-Modified indicates the resource's last modification time, example: Last-Modified:Wed,21Oct201507:28:00GMT.

In PHP, password_hash and password_verify functions should be used to implement secure password hashing, and MD5 or SHA1 should not be used. 1) password_hash generates a hash containing salt values to enhance security. 2) Password_verify verify password and ensure security by comparing hash values. 3) MD5 and SHA1 are vulnerable and lack salt values, and are not suitable for modern password security.
